I have whirlpool refrigrator top freezer, model w10142155a. problem is that its both fan does not work, the fan with compresor and the fan on freezer both are still...!! we tryied much to rotate the fans...

If both of your fans and the compressor is not running you are having one of two problems.

1st and most usual problem is faulty defrost timer. To check this you must find where your defrost timer is located (usually this is mounted in the fridge section on the celing near the thermostat) Take a flat head screwdriver and turn the timer untill the fridge comes on. If you turn it and it clicks and the fridge comes on you should replace the defrost timer.

2nd you may have a faulty thermostat. To check this you need to locate the thermostat in your fridge (this is the one that supplies power to all the components) find where the two wires connect in to it. Disconnect power and disconnect thoes two wire. With a ohm meter or a multi meter your need to read continuity across the two spades on the thermostat at the same time turn the knob on the thermostat untill you hear an audiable beep from the meter or you read resistance across the two spades.

From what you have stated above I believe your problem is going to be a faulty defrost timer.

My fridge wasnt cold yesterday but the light was on and the freezer worked but this morning the freezer has started to defrost and everything was warm in the fridge

If you cant hear the compressor running and he fan under the fridge and in the freezer compartment are not running. The problem would be your defrost timer has quit on the defrost mode. Your defrost timer should be located in the fridge side behind the back plastic liner or if your controls and light are in the center top it will be there. The timer is plastic with a metal motor on one side. There is a shaft in the center that a flatblade screw driver will fit in turn it and you will hear audible clicks and the fans and compressor should kick in. I hope this helps. If the fans are working but the compressor is not the compressor is bad or the start relay on the compressor may be bad it is located under a plastic cap on the compressor and is about the size of a nickle and is connected to one of the 3 prongs coming out of the compressor. Remember to always unplug the fridge before working on it. good luck

Freezer is ok, but fridge is not cold enough

5 reasons for fridge and/or freezer getting warm: 1- the evaporator coils are icing up and won?t let air circulate. 2- the evaporator fan is not working to circulate air. 3- there is no refrigerant in the system. 4- no power to fridge or compressor. 5- the condenser coils have no air circulation check under the fridge behind the vent. if it is too dusty or the fan isn?t working, it is not getting enough airflow to cool down. replace fan and/or vacuum out the dust. if there is no power to the fridge, the light will be off. if the compressor is not running, there is a defrost timer that cuts the power temporarily to the compressor to melt ice on the coils. it?s located under the fridge behind the bottom vent. If the timer is off and the compressor is not going, the compressor or the main board is bad and needs replacing. there is also a temperature sensor on the evaporator coils that tells the defrost coil to turn on and when to turn off. if the defrost timer is on but the coil is not heating up, replace the sensor. if it still won?t heat up, it?s the timer or the coil. the easiest way to tell if there is no refrigerant- the freezer wall is warm and the compressor is loud. if there is no refrigerant, it may be more cost effective to replace the fridge. if you feel no air coming from the freezer vent, the fan needs replacing. If you feel air moving in the freezer but not the fridge, the channel from freezer to fridge is blocked.
